Increase £20 by 15%
Method 1Find 15%10% = £2 5% = £1 so 15% = £3
Now add it on to £20£20 + £3 = £23
Increase by 15% so
1.15 is the multiplier

Decrease £60 by 5%
Method 1
Find 5% of £60
10% = £6 5% = £3
Subtract from £60
£60 - £3 = £57
Method 2
A decrease of 5% is same as 95% of original amount
So 0.95 x £60 = £57 95% of original amount means 0.95 is the multiplier

Compound Interest
• £1,000 in bank earns 5% interest per year. How much will you have in 3 years?
After 1 year 1000 x 1.05 = 1050
After 2 years 1050 x 1.05= 1102.50
After 3 years 1102.50 x 1.05 = 1157.63
OR 1000 x 1.05 x 1.05 x1.05=
1000 x 1.05³=£1157.63
1.05 is the multiplier!
